Summary

The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has issued proposed changes to air quality rules, implementing directives from Executive Order 10. This action is part of a broader initiative to update environmental regulations and is currently in the draft stage, open for public comment.

What changed

The EPA has published a proposed rule that amends existing air quality regulations, aligning them with the objectives outlined in Executive Order 10. This action signifies a substantive change in the agency's approach to air quality management, though specific details of the amendments and their direct impact will be elaborated in the full regulatory text and supporting documents.

Regulated entities, particularly those in sectors with significant air emissions, should review the proposed changes to understand new or modified compliance obligations. The document is currently in a draft stage, indicating that public comments are being solicited. Compliance officers should prepare to submit feedback by the specified comment close date to influence the final rule. Failure to comply with the final rule, once enacted, could result in penalties.
